Press Info:
UK-born producer Luke Standing aka Blue Hour has made a considerable impact since his emergence in 2013. A move from Bristol to Berlin precipitated a run of stellar self-released EPs that immediately won him an ardent following among techno’s most revered DJs for a sound that offered a fresh takes on classic techno and electronica, while always maintaining a supreme dancefloor functionality. Among those fans was Function, who included an exclusive track from Standing in his Berghain 07 mix and part I of its accompanying 12-inches.

Now Standing’s self-titled outlet launches a new remix series, calling on some of those aforementioned fans to offer their own takes on a trio of the standout tracks from his label’s first five releases. Ostgut resident Answer Code Request applies the driving hybrid techno-bass approach that has made him one of Berghain’s brightest stars to Blue Hour 002 title cut Axis Motive; Paris-based Tresor resident offers an ethereal take that focuses on Blue Hour 003’s Reference 97’s more hypnotic elements; and Ostgut Ton’s Steffi is perfectly matched to the third EP’s Moments, employing her signature sound that similarly offers a timeless anthemic quality to the original.

Press Info:
Succeeding his profound and forward-thinking album ‘Depth Charged’ which was revealed last February, Terence Fixmer returns with ‘Depth Charged Remixed’ featuring Ostgut Ton’s Answer Code Request and UK’s underground techno hero Steve Bicknell.

‘Elevation’, originally the final track of the album, emotional and reflective, is kicked up a notch by ACR’s Patrick Gräser by adding ponderous drum patterns making it perfect for the floor. Conversely, Steve Bicknell takes on ‘Unforeseen’. With it’s fast paced rolling bass it is now put into top gear shivering with feverish reverberations.

To compliment each variation, included on the EP are Fixmer’s own live versions that have energetically filled dance floors throughout his tour.

Press Info:
KEY Vinyl don their scouting caps once again for another split EP featuring fledgling and debuting talents. First up is The Plant Worker. This French DJ and producer isn’t exactly new to the game, but as The Plant Worker he’s been slowly journeying down harder, rawer trajectories—as the name may suggest. With a trio of EPs out already, “Iota 001” and “Iota 002” continues his exploration into purer techno forms with two cuts of deep, probing, loopy floor material.

Then on the flip, KEY Vinyl unveil the first works from masked newcomer Transient X4. “Lost In Perceptions” is a jangling sic fi trip to techno’s bleak and pitch-black periphery, whilst “Ways To Space” sends its cosmic theme off for a spell in the basement, coming out as a monstrous peak-time send off.
